  1. Mandaic is a southeastern Aramaic language dialect type in use by the Mandaean community, traditionally based in southern parts of Iraq and Iran, for their religious books. Classical Mandaic is still employed by Mandaean priests in liturgical rites.
    Native speakers: 5,500 (2001–2006)
    Native to: Iraq and Iran
    Region: Iraq – Baghdad, Basra Iran – Khuzistan
    Writing system: Mandaic alphabet

    What language did the Mandaeans speak?
    The language in which the Mandaean religious literature was originally written is known as Mandaic, and is a member of the Aramaic family of dialects. It is written in a cursive variant of the Parthian chancellory script. The majority of Mandaean lay people do not speak this language.
    What is the Mandaic alphabet?
    The Mandaic alphabet appears to be based on the Aramaic alphabet and first appeared sometime during the 2nd century AD. The Mandaic name for the alphabet is Abagada or Abaga, after the first few letters. The Mandaeans believe that all the letters of their alphabet have magical properties, and impart mysteries ( raze ).

    Neo-Mandaic, sometimes called the "ratna" (Arabic: رطنة raṭna "jargon"), is the modern reflex of the Mandaic language, the liturgical language of the Mandaean religious community of Iraq and Iran. Although severely endangered, it survives today as the first language of a small number of Mandaeans (possibly as few as 100–200 speakers) in Iran and in the Mandaean diaspora.
